What are some different styles of bicycle carriers?

Bicycle carriers are typically available in three types: roof racks, hitch-mount racks and strap-on trunk racks. Two important factors when selecting a bicycle carrier are the intended car type and the number of bikes to transport.
Roof rack bicycle carriers use mounting feet and clips that attach to a vehicle's upper door frame or rain gutters, or they attach to a vehicle's existing rack and crossbars. Roof racks require lifting the bike and placing it into the rack mounts on the roof of the car.
Hitch-mount racks are available in a variety of sizes to match the class of hitch on the vehicle. A hitch-mount rack requires lifting the bicycle about waist-high to place it on the tire tray or strap it to the carrier arm.
Strap-on trunk racks attach to a car's trunk, hatchback or rear bumper. Mount a bicycle on the plastic-coated carrier arms by lifting it about waist-high.
